Select Medical Holdings Corp. (SEM), the parent of Select Medical Corporation, announced the pricing of an initial public offering of 30 million shares of its common stock at $10.00 per share. The shares will be listed on the New York Stock Exchange under the Symbol "SEM."
The closing of the offering is expected to occur on September 30, 2009, subject to the satisfaction of customary closing conditions. The underwriters will be granted a 30-day option to purchase an additional 4.50 million shares of common stock from Select.
